Comprehensive Heating Tune-Up Checklist
At Tario Heating, our heating tune-up service in Eldersburg follows a detailed, industry-leading inspection and maintenance process tailored to your specific furnace model. Our experienced technicians perform the following critical tasks:
- Cleaning Burners and Coils: Removing dirt, soot, and debris to improve ignition and heat transfer efficiency.
- Checking the Heat Exchanger: Inspecting for cracks or damage that could lead to unsafe emissions or loss of heat.
- Lubricating Motors and Moving Parts: Ensuring all mechanical components run smoothly without unnecessary friction.
- Verifying Airflow and Ductwork: Assessing vents and ducts for blockages or leaks that reduce heating effectiveness.
- Testing Safety Controls: Confirming that limit switches, sensors, and controls are functioning correctly to prevent hazards.
- Measuring Carbon Monoxide Levels: Detecting any dangerous CO leaks to safeguard your family’s health.
- Checking Thermostat Operation: Verifying accuracy and responsiveness for consistent temperature control.
Common Heating Problems in Eldersburg Homes and How Tune-Ups Help
Many Eldersburg residents face recurring heating issues that can often be mitigated or prevented through professional tune-ups. These common problems include:
- Uneven Heating: Caused by clogged filters, restricted airflow, or duct leaks.
- Strange Noises: Often due to worn belts, bearings needing lubrication, or loose components.
- Frequent Cycling: A furnace turning on and off frequently may indicate thermostat or airflow problems.
- Increased Energy Bills: Dirt buildup or malfunctioning parts force the system to work harder, using more fuel.
- Burner Ignition Failures: Dirty burners or faulty ignition systems can prevent the furnace from lighting properly.
- Carbon Monoxide Risks: Cracks in the heat exchanger or poor venting increase CO exposure risk without detection.
Scheduling timely tune-ups allows Tario Heating to diagnose, clean, and adjust these components early before they escalate into breakdowns or hazardous situations.

FAQs about Heating Tune-Ups in Eldersburg, MD
Q: How long does a heating tune-up take?
A: Typically, a professional heating tune-up with Tario Heating takes around 60 to 90 minutes, depending on your system’s complexity and condition.
Q: Can a tune-up reduce my heating bills?
A: Yes. A clean, well-adjusted furnace runs more efficiently, which can lower your energy usage and reduce heating bills by up to 15%.
Q: Is it safe to run my heating system without a tune-up?
A: Running a heating system without regular maintenance increases the risk of carbon monoxide leaks, breakdowns, and inefficient performance, which can compromise safety and comfort.
Q: How often should I have my furnace tuned up?
A: An annual tune-up before the heating season starts is generally recommended, especially in regions like Eldersburg with cold winters.
